Product Introduction

Overview

The AD589KH is a 2-terminal, low-cost, temperature-compensated bandgap voltage reference produced by Analog Devices Inc. This component provides a fixed 1.23 V output voltage for input currents ranging from 50 µA to 5.0 mA. It is designed to offer high stability, primarily due to the matching and thermal tracking of the on-chip components. The AD589KH utilizes Analog Devices' precision bipolar processing and thin-film technology to achieve excellent performance at a low cost.

Key Features

  • Temperature-compensated bandgap voltage reference with a fixed 1.23 V output voltage.
  • Operates with input currents between 50 µA and 5.0 mA.
  • No external components required to maintain full accuracy under changing load conditions due to low output impedance.
  • High stability ensured by the matching and thermal tracking of on-chip components.
  • Available in various grades for different temperature ranges (0°C to +70°C and -55°C to +125°C).
  • Low cost and high performance due to precision bipolar processing and thin-film technology.

Applications

The AD589KH is suitable for a variety of applications where a stable and accurate voltage reference is required. These include:

  • Power supply systems needing a precise voltage reference.
  • Analog-to-digital converters (ADCs) and digital-to-analog converters (DACs) for accurate voltage referencing.
  • Instrumentation and measurement equipment requiring stable voltage references.
  • Industrial control systems and automation where precise voltage levels are necessary.
